Test Drive: Sleds
Eight of the best downhill rides for kids of all ages

If we thought all you wanted was the quickest way down the hill, you'd be looking at a photograph of a cafeteria tray, or maybe a kiddie-pool-turned-family-size-flying-saucer. But the current designs recognize that there is more to life than just getting to the bottom: New models come equipped with efficient steering and stop-on-a-dime brakes, as well as easy storage and portability. To whittle down the lot, our rosy-cheeked test pilots (both large and small) traveled to the Langjökull glacier in Iceland—we don't mess around—and then ranked sleds based on safety, comfort, portability, and, yes, even speed.
